If you’re looking for the ultimate Outer Banks vacation rental for your next stay in Nags Head, look no further than this beautiful oceanfront home. With a private walkway to the beach, a Private Pool and Hot Tub, this 8-Bedroom home is the perfect place for you and your family group to make memories on the OBX.

NautiBuoy boasts a beautiful theater room, rec room, and more than enough deck space to take in those beautiful Outer Banks sunrises over the ocean. And since it sits in close proximity to everything you could possibly need, you’ll want to make NautiBuoy your forever vacation rental after your first night here!

For golf enthusiasts, NautiBuoy, is located in the Village at Nags Head community close to the Nags Head Golf Links Championship Golf Course. Just imagine playing 18-holes with the beautiful sound serving as the backdrop.

Of course, with such a convenient location to great restaurants, local shops, and must-see attractions, there is plenty to do even if you’re not an avid golfer! Easily walk (or drive) to nearby grocery stores to stock up on the supplies you need to cook at home in the gourmet kitchen or meander around the Outer Banks Mall for a day of shopping.

Because you’re on the southern end of town, NautiBuoy is convenient to great day-trip areas like Pea Island and the Cape Hatteras National Seashore where you’ll enjoy bird watching, beachcombing, watersports, and more. Take a short drive to the Outer Banks Fishing Pier with Fish Heads Bar & Grill to enjoy some of the best of fishing, dining, and relaxing to the sound of the waves! Spend a few hours on Roanoke Island for shopping, dining and attractions, including Manteo’s downtown waterfront overlooking the Elizabeth II sailing vessel (a part of the maritime museum located on the Roanoke Island festival park), and the Roanoke Marshes lighthouse. Take in a viewing of the renowned Lost Colony outdoor production and visit the beautiful Elizabethan Gardens, both located on Fort Raleigh National Historic Site. Make time for the North Carolina Aquarium and Island Farm as well!

This home completed renovations in 2023, adding several enhancements for entertaining, plus all new top-of-the-line furniture, décor, appliances, flooring, large picture windows, new fixtures, an elevator, new 6-person hot tub, a swing bed on the covered deck overlooking the pool and beach, and new front East facing decks offering views of the sound with ample seating.

Ground Level: Bedroom w/King w/Smart TV, Bedroom w/Pyramid Bunk w/Smart TV, Hall Full Bath w/Tub/Shower combo w/Access to Pool Area, Den w/Smart TV & Full-Size Refrigerator, Elevator.

Mid-Level: 5 Master Bedrooms with King beds, and ensuite bathrooms, 1 Master Bedroom w/Queen, and ensuite bathroom, Elevator. All rooms have personal heating/cooling options with separate mini-split units.

Upper Level: Expansive Great Room with multiple spaces for entertaining, relaxing, and enjoying time with loved ones. Cozy sitting area w/Gas Fireplace (Nov. - Apr. only.), and Wet Bar including an icemaker, wine and beverage fridge. The Large Gourmet Kitchen has double appliances in addition to professional-grade gas oven/stove, a large walk-in pantry frees up counter space with tons of storage, a microwave, and beverage fridge. The large Island has 4 Stools, the Dining Area w/Table has room for 16, plus a Bar Top Table that seats 4. The Game Area has a Pool Table, Arcade Game w/ 60+ games, & Shuffleboard, a Poker/Puzzle Table, Theatre Room with oversized plush seating, Powder Room, Elevator, Access to Sun Deck & Covered Deck.

**2024 Pool Dates: 5/4-10/11**

Pool Heat Fee: $450 (Pool Heat NOT Available for June, July or August)
Please note that pool heat can only raise the temperature 10 degrees higher than the consistent ambient air temperature (60 degrees and higher, pool heat does not work if the air temperature is below 60 degrees), and that pool heat systems vary in capability based on temperature and other factors.

Independently owned by a member of one of the Outer Banks’ oldest families, the Ben Franklin store is stocked with just about everything a visitor would need to go to the beach.

 

Ben Franklin stores were once part of a five-and-dime retail empire, with about 2,500 locations across the country in its heyday. As decades passed and the times and customers began to change, many closed their doors, leading to fewer than 150 of these nostalgic shops. Nags Head Ben Franklin, however, has withstood the test of time and adapted to the needs of its customers to provide a memorable shopping experience on the Outer Banks.

 

Debbie Terry Tolson, manager of the Ben Franklin location in Nags Head, recalls working with former owner Tommie Daniels. Daniels’ father, Moncie Daniels, started the business in downtown Manteo in the early 1900s. The Daniels family has been a longstanding fixture in the Outer Banks business community—Moncie even sold gas to the Wright brothers in 1903.

 

Tommie, with an excellent business mind, saw the opportunity the new Bypass presented and, in 1977, he opened the Nags Head location of Ben Franklin. He was one of the first businesses on the Bypass,” Tolson says.In addition to a new location, the Ben Franklin store saw a new group of customers.

 

“People would come from all around because Tommie had a little bit of everything—it was more like a five and 10 then,” Tolson explains. “As he went to the beach, he began to get more tourists, so he started catering more and more to visitors.”

 

Today, the 21,000-square-foot souvenir shop quickly catches the attention of anyone driving by thanks to the ocean-themed mural that decorates the façade of the building, painted by local artist Rob Snyder. This Ben Franklin location has become the must-stop shop for both first-time visitors to the area and generations of families who escape to the Outer Banks annually.

 

Tolson credits the great prices and friendly customer service to the success of the location, which keeps families returning.“People come in all the time and tell me, ‘my grandmother or my grandfather used to bring me here and now I’m bringing my children,’” she shares. “One of my favorite parts about working here is seeing the people come back year after year.”
